Thesis Overview

The research project, titled "The Impact of Mindfulness-Based Interventions on Stress and Anxiety Levels of College Students," aims to investigate the effectiveness of mindfulness-based interventions in reducing stress and anxiety levels among college students. Mindfulness practices have gained popularity in recent years as a potential tool for promoting mental well-being and managing stress. The study will delve into how mindfulness techniques can be applied specifically to the college student population, who often face high levels of academic pressure and psychological challenges. The research will explore existing literature on mindfulness-based interventions and their impact on stress and anxiety reduction. By conducting a systematic review of relevant studies, the project aims to provide a comprehensive overview of the current evidence supporting the use of mindfulness practices in addressing stress and anxiety among college students. The methodology of the research will involve designing and implementing a mindfulness-based intervention program tailored to the needs of college students. This program will incorporate various mindfulness techniques, such as mindfulness meditation, breathing exercises, and body scans, to help participants develop awareness, acceptance, and non-judgmental attitudes towards their thoughts and emotions. Data collection will involve pre- and post-intervention assessments of stress and anxiety levels using standardized psychological measures. Qualitative data will also be gathered through interviews or focus groups to explore the subjective experiences and perceived benefits of the mindfulness program among participants. The findings of the research are expected to contribute valuable insights into the practical implications of incorporating mindfulness-based interventions into college counseling services or mental health programs. The project aims to highlight the potential of mindfulness practices as a cost-effective and accessible approach to promoting mental well-being and reducing stress and anxiety levels among college students. Overall, this research overview underscores the significance of investigating the impact of mindfulness-based interventions on stress and anxiety levels in the college student population. By exploring the effectiveness of these interventions and their potential benefits, the study aims to provide valuable contributions to the field of guidance and counseling, as well as inform the development of evidence-based interventions to support the mental health and well-being of college students.
